Set up RADIUS servers If you use WPA2 Enterprise security, WPA3 Enterprise security, or a RADIUS MAC ACL, you must set up RADIUS servers for authentication or both authentication and accounting using RADIUS. You must set up a primary IPv4 server and you can set up a secondary IPv4 server. These RADIUS server settings apply either to all WiFi networks that use WPA2 Enterprise security or WPA3 Enterprise security (see Set up an open or secure WiFi network on page 58) or to all WiFi networks that use a RADIUS MAC ACL. Note: Either WPA2 Enterprise security or WPA3 Enterprise security and a RADIUS MAC ACL are mutually exclusive. If you want to use a RADIUS MAC ACL for a WiFi network, select a different type of WiFi security (see Set up an open or secure WiFi network on page 58). If you want to use WPA2 Enterprise security or WPA3 Enterprise security for a WiFi network, use a local MAC ACL (see Manage local MAC access control lists on page 116). If you use a RADIUS MAC ACL, you must define the ACL on the RADIUS server, using the format in the following example for client MAC addresses in the RADIUS server: If the client MAC address is 00:0a:95:9d:68:16, specify it as 000a959d6816 in the RADIUS server. To set up RADIUS servers: 1. Launch a web browser from a computer that is connected to the same network as the access point or directly to the access point through an Ethernet cable or WiFi connection. 2. Enter the IP address that is assigned to the access point. A login window displays. If your browser displays a security warning, you can proceed, or add an exception for the security warning. For more information, see What to do if you get a browser security warning on page 43. 3. Enter the access point user name and password. The user name is admin. The password is the one that you specified. The user name and password are case-sensitive.
